Receipt Entry Detail Window

Use this window to create receipts by entering an ID Number, payment, and payment details. These payments can include student payments, parent payments, or payments by a third party. Payments can be associated with a payment plan or applied to a student life sanction fine.

This window can be used to generate a debit to an account for special charges that are not automatically created by the charges generation process.

For the first receipt you save, you must indicate a receipt number from the Form Control window. When all information is entered and the receipt is saved, the receipt prints (depending on the value selected in the Print Receipt column) and all other receipts are automatically numbered in the sequence they are added.

Use the bottom of the window to enter the specific transaction details, such as the transaction amount, check number, ABA number, and transaction description. When you select the type of receipt from the A/R Code drop-down options, the Account Code, Transaction Description, and Subsidiary Code are automatically completed.

To create additional folio options, right-click in the Check Number column and select Maintenance Screen.
